Output 31a27d77f7e3aea16e7e026bd01a7577ffb99ffbb856048a29ae2125d639949f:1

value
32890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f66e2ccd90c3bafdc0cedcd09df9cb826a54a98 OP_EQUAL
address
MKWoJS4k45PQgHwiVda3t26hyAiT1f1XBx
transaction
31a27d77f7e3aea16e7e026bd01a7577ffb99ffbb856048a29ae2125d639949f
spent
true